prints larger than 512 can be used. Example, my drive-in video uses prints that are 1024x512. So a 1024x1024 should still work, and even a 2048x2048 could potentially work.
(but the prints were in a folder named "print_1x16" meaning it doesnt show up on 1x1 and 2x2 print bricks, only the special movie wall brick i made uses them)

and robin, make sure the prints also have an icon folder with every print being exactly 64x64, or else the print wont show up for use.
